About this job

We are seeking a hardworking individual to lead targeted research efforts on a range of AI ethics and policy topics to support internal decision making and external engagement with enterprise customers. The successful candidate will have proven research experience, excellent writing and communication skills, and will be comfortable analysing technical literature and engaging substantively with domain experts. Our ideal candidate will be motivated by the idea using AI technologies for widespread public benefit and scientific discovery.

Responsibilities



  • Carry out highly-targeted research on a diverse range of AI ethics and policy topics, to inform internal decision making and external engagement with enterprise customers.
  • Manage and complete complex research programmes.
  • Design the right blend of literature reviews, media audits, expert interviews, third party support, and quantitative techniques for the specific topic, audience and goal in question.
  • Produce insightful, engaging and actionable research papers, memos and risk analysis that are easily digestible by senior decision makers and external stakeholders.
  • Embed deeply into OptimalAI’s science and ethics research and interpret it for non-specialist audiences, drawing out clear implications for internal decision making and external policy.
  • Proactively build robust relationships across the company to inform your research and to identify opportunities for how your work can support other teams.
  • Monitor relevant external developments closely, cultivate relationships with external domain experts and stakeholders, and share targeted updates with internal audiences.
